Glass substrate for magnetic recording medium, magnetic recording medium, and method of manufacturing the same

1. A method of manufacturing a glass substrate for a magnetic recording medium for forming a predetermined roughness, comprising the steps of:

  • precisely polishing a principal surface of the glass substrate by the use of polishing material containing free abrasive grain, generating remaining stress distribution for a portion of a polishing trace due to the free abrasive grain on the surface of the glass substrate, performing a surface process for at least the principal surface of the glass substrate by the use of hydrosilicofluoric acid, and deciding a portion having relatively high remaining distortion in the generated remaining stress distribution as an island portion, the glass substrate being heated after precisely polishing before performing the surface process by the use of the hydrosilicofluoric acid.
